### Ticket: Fix undo/redo stack corruption in Plumeline editor

Undo history in the Plumeline diagram editor corrupts when a group-move is interleaved with an autosave snapshot: redo replays stale node positions. Fix: make snapshotting read-only against the command stack and tag each command with a monotonic sequence id. Maintainers: the stack lives in `history/commandlog.ts`; do not mutate entries in place, ever. Tests added for group-move, paste, and connector reroute cases. Merging requires sign-off from the engineer named below.

named custodian: Oliath Ralax

**Mgmt Meeting Minutes — Retiring the Brightline Range**

Quick recap for sales leads at Fenholt Supplies: we agreed to retire the Brightline fixture range by year-end. Remaining stock moves to clearance pricing next month, and accounts on standing orders get migrated to the Lumetta range. Trade-in incentives were approved in principle. The confidential note on next steps sits just below.

board note of bajof-bajeg: The pricing group signed off on a budget of $13.4 million for Project Sildor. The renewal with Lamixek Holdings closes at $48.9 million a year, 49 percent above the last contract.

Handover for the driver's coordinator: sealed exam papers for the Crestwold Institute go out tomorrow on the 7am run. Tamper bands checked by Marta Veld this evening; box count is six, all logged. Driver must not break seals or leave the vehicle unattended. Give the courier the release phrase noted below.

handover note for tadug-yaguf: the aldath pelwyn courier leaves the casox norwyn briix silok zorok kasdor aldion quenox ledger at gate 2653 under passcode 959015